
Lawtey and the surrounding piney flatwoods of Bradford County are defined by a network of early twentieth-century rail lines and small rural schoolhouses. The Seaboard Airline and Georgia Southern and Florida railroads anchor the local economy, connecting settlements like Raiford and Maxville through the dense New River Swamp. This period shows a landscape deeply integrated with agricultural and institutional life, notably featuring the Bradford Farms (State Prison) and its namesake Bradford Farms Junction.
